raggie, you might also enjoy music by the Funk Brothers. They backed the Supremes, Temptations, Stevie Wonder, Four Tops, Jimmy Ruffin, Martha Reeves and many others from 1958 - 1970's. They had more hits than the Beach Boys, Beatles, and Elvis COMBINED! The Funk Brothers WERE Motown - not exactly pure rock & roll but they rocked just the same.
